20世紀上半葉日本學者對中國數(shù)學史的研究

【摘要】:20世紀上半葉日本學者對中國數(shù)學史的研究具有較高水平,無論是對內容的理解還是對方法論的創(chuàng)新,他們的研究在東亞乃至世界科學史界都具有引領作用。本文選取20世紀上半葉具有代表性的四位日本學者:三上義夫、林鶴一、藤原松三郎和小倉金之助為研究對象,通過考察他們有關中國數(shù)學史的研究及其主要成果,探討他們對中國數(shù)學史研究所產(chǎn)生的影響和深遠意義。本文在前人工作的基礎上,利用文獻研究法、個案研究法、比較研究法和綜合研究法,基于原始文獻,解讀了三上義夫、林鶴一、藤原松三郎和小倉金之助關于中國數(shù)學史研究的重要論著。本文共分六章。第1章緒論,說明了研究目的與意義、研究問題、文獻綜述、所采用的研究方法及擬創(chuàng)新之處。第2章論述了三上義夫對中國數(shù)學史的研究。通過對他的代表作《中日數(shù)學發(fā)達史》、《中國算學之特色》的介紹,基于他對《九章算術》劉徽注、宋元時期的天元術、四元術、招差法以及清代割圓術和《疇人傳》等的研究,對比中國學者的研究成果,分析三上的成就主要體現(xiàn)在:1、對中國數(shù)學史走向世界做了開創(chuàng)性工作。2、在一定程度上糾正了西方學者關于中國數(shù)學的某些偏見和科學史上“西方中心論”的錯誤觀點。3、對中國數(shù)學史的研究發(fā)揮了引領作用。4、三上對中算是和算的母體認識深刻,對和算與中算的關聯(lián)研究比較透徹。5、三上提出和實踐了從文化史視角研究數(shù)學史具有重要借鑒意義。第3章考察了林鶴一和藤原松三郎對中國數(shù)學史的研究工作。考察林鶴一對弧背綴術和圓周率的研究、對“幾何”和“代數(shù)”詞源的研究、對中國素數(shù)問題的研究,指出其成就主要體現(xiàn)在用現(xiàn)代數(shù)學來介紹中算成果,并將其與日本、西方的相關成果進行比較、聯(lián)系,指出林鶴一是從數(shù)學家的角度研究數(shù)學史的。梳理了藤原松三郎對《楊輝算法》和《算法統(tǒng)宗》中方程式解法的研究及其對宋元明數(shù)學史史料的研究。他的成就主要體現(xiàn)在:1、對中算典籍的整理,特別是宋元明數(shù)學史料的整理做出了貢獻,發(fā)現(xiàn)了我國未見到的史料《新鐫啟蒙便用九章算法全書》和《新鐫九龍易訣算法》。2、用現(xiàn)代數(shù)學對中算進行算法闡釋。第4章分析小倉金之助對中國數(shù)學史的研究。通過對小倉的論文《中國數(shù)學的特殊性》、《中國數(shù)學的社會性》、《極東數(shù)學國際化與產(chǎn)業(yè)革命》的分析,指出他的成就主要體現(xiàn)在:注重研究數(shù)學的社會性,從數(shù)學知識的研究演變到文化背景、社會史的研究,比中國同時代的數(shù)學史研究者的視野更加寬廣。第5章對日本學者的數(shù)學史研究方法進行了探討。概括出三上既從內史的角度研究中國數(shù)學史,又從文化史的角度研究和算史;林鶴一和藤原松三郎從內史的角度研究中國數(shù)學史;小倉首次從社會史的角度研究中國數(shù)學史。三上和小倉在方法論上的創(chuàng)新,在國際數(shù)學史界具有重要的意義。第6章為結語,對于四位學者研究中國數(shù)學史的動因、成就與不足、與我國學者的交流以及對中日學者的影響做了總結。主要結論如下:1.明治維新后,日本決定廢和算、學洋算,因而和算日益衰退。日本數(shù)學史家三上、數(shù)學家林鶴一、藤原,數(shù)學教育家小倉是在這種時代背景下研究和算的,某種意義上是為了保護民族傳統(tǒng)文化。他們的知識結構不同,所以他們的研究視角和研究方法不同。2.他們從事的現(xiàn)代意義上的中國數(shù)學史研究具有開創(chuàng)性,而從文化史的或社會史的視角來研究數(shù)學史,也屬于科學史領域外史研究方面的先驅性工作,在科學編史學方面具有重要意義。3.他們深厚的數(shù)學功底,較強的中文文獻解讀能力以及使用西方語言發(fā)表數(shù)學史論文對在世界范圍內傳播和推動中國數(shù)學史研究發(fā)揮了重要作用。4.他們與我國學者的交流,推動了中國數(shù)學史的研究。他們的研究工作對中日學者都產(chǎn)生了深遠影響。
